On Sun, Dec 01, 2002 at 01:03:41PM -0500, Bruce Park wrote: > I'm still having difficulty in setting up my USB mouse for woody. Since I > am currently kernel 2.4.bf2.4, my assumption is that the USB drivers are > already loaded. When I setup X, I chose /dev/input/mice for the my mouse > path. Is there anyone that can help me getting this correct? > As always, all help is greatly appreciated. Easy way: 'apt-get install kernel-image-2.4.19-arch hotplug', where arch is 386, 686, etc. Reboot into the new kernel and hotplug should automatically detect your mouse and create the approriate device nodes and such. -rob
